Troubleshooting Operation Symptom Cause and solution Reference pages • Is the AC adaptor securely connected to the AC outlet? - - - • If the power plug of the AC adaptor connected properly? - - - • Is the LAN cable connected securely to the LAN connector for IP control ? page 18 No power • Is the network cable for the PoE++ (IEEE 802.3bt compliant) compatible power supply device and the unit connected properly? Installation Instructions → "Connections" → "System example 3 (IP image transmission, PoE++)" • Power may not be supplied if the total power limit is exceeded on power supply devices that allow connections to multiple PoE++ terminals. → For details, refer to the operating instructions for the PoE++ power supply device. - - - • If the unit is connected to the controller, has it been connected properly? → For details, refer to the operating instructions for the controller. Installation Instructions → "Connections" • When performing operations from a wireless remote control → Also refer to the "Cannot operate using the wireless remote control" item. - - - Cannot operate (c ommon to wireless remote control, controller) • Is the power on? → If the unit's status display lamp is off or lights up orange, it means that the unit's power is not on. • The safe mode function may have been activated. • Have the limiter functions been set? page 35 page 164 pages 162 to 163 • Has the unit you want to operate been selected properly? page 36 Cannot operate using the wireless remote control • Have the remote control's batteries run down or have the batteries been installed with their polarities reversed? → If the status display lamp does not blink even when the wireless remote control is operated near the wireless remote control signal light-sensing area, it means that the batteries have run down. Replace the batteries. • Have the IR ID switches been set correctly? - - - page 19, page 30 • Is there a fluorescent light or plasma monitor near the unit and, if so, is the wireless remote control signal light-sensing area exposed to its light? page 16 • Is the unit connected to the controller properly? → For details, refer to the operating instructions for the controller. Installation Instructions → "Connections" Cannot operate using the controller • It may be necessary to upgrade the version of the controller so that the controller will support the unit. → For details on upgrading, visit the support page on the following website. https://pro-av.panasonic.net/ - - - The unit turns in the opposite direction to the one operated • Has the stand-alone (Desktop) installation setting been selected correctly? • The reversal setting may have been established at the controller if the unit is connected to the controller. → For details, refer to the operating instructions for the controller. page 73, page 108 - - - 165
